The highly desirable village of Wylye is situated within an area of Outstanding Natural Beauty and benefits from some simply gorgeous scenery. Local amenities include a church, village hall and The Bell Inn public house. Wylye also offers excellent road links being only 1 mile from the A303 and the A36 bypasses the village providing access to Salisbury and Warminster both approximately 12 miles from the village. The Cathedral city of Salisbury has a comprehensive choice of schools as well as excellent shopping and recreational facilities which include a theatre, cinema, arts centre, restaurants, pubs, clubs, supermarkets, dentists, doctors’ surgeries, hairdressers, library, leisure centre and fitness gym. The city also has 5 Park & Ride services for ease of access into the city centre. A303 (London/Exeter) 1m, Salisbury 12m, Warminster 12m, Tisbury 10m . Trains: Tisbury (London Waterloo 110mins), Salisbury (London Waterloo 85 mins), Warminster (Bristol Temple Meads 48mins).
